Washington – Washington State Sues Lobbyists over Campaign against GMO Labeling Reuters – Carey Gillam | Published: 10/16/2013 The state of Washington filed a lawsuit alleging the Grocery Manufacturers Association illegally collected and spent more than $7 million while shielding the identity of its donors in an effort to oppose Ballot Initiative 522, which would require labeling of genetically modified foods.
